How Does A Milk Run Work?

How does a milk run work?

A milk run is an efficient routing strategy used in logistics to optimize delivery operations, making it a crucial aspect of modern supply chain management. By closely grouping delivery destinations based on proximity and volume, milk runs ensure that routes are as cost-effective as possible. For instance, a local grocery store might arrange a milk run to deliver goods to nearby restaurants and cafes, minimizing fuel consumption and driving time. Unlike traditional methods that may involve multiple separate deliveries, milk runs consolidate shipments, thus reducing overall delivery times and ensuring consistent customer satisfaction. To implement an effective milk run, businesses should first map out their delivery zones, categorize their customers by similar delivery windows, and utilize route optimization software for real-time adjustments. This systematic approach not only saves on transportation costs but also enhances logistics efficiency, aligning perfectly with the objective of reducing both environmental impact and operational expenses.

What are the advantages of using a milk run?

Implementing a milk run logistics strategy can bring numerous benefits to businesses, particularly those in the manufacturing and supply chain industries. A milk run is a type of delivery route where a single vehicle, often a truck or van, follows a regular schedule to pick up goods or materials from multiple suppliers or locations, and then transports them to a central hub or distribution point. The advantages of using a milk run include reduced transportation costs, improved supply chain efficiency, and increased visibility into the movement of goods. By consolidating shipments and making multiple pickups along a single route, companies can minimize the number of vehicles on the road, lower fuel consumption, and decrease emissions. Additionally, milk run routes can help to streamline inventory management, reduce the risk of stockouts or overstocking, and enhance collaboration with suppliers. For example, a company that implements a milk run program with its suppliers may be able to reduce its transportation costs by 10-20%, while also improving delivery times and increasing customer satisfaction. Overall, the milk run strategy offers a cost-effective and efficient way to manage logistics and improve supply chain performance.

What types of industries can benefit from a milk run?

A milk run, a logistics strategy involving the consolidation of multiple shipments into a single vehicle, can significantly benefit various industries by enhancing supply chain efficiency and reducing costs. Industries that typically benefit from a milk run include manufacturing, where components are sourced from multiple suppliers and consolidated for production; retail, where goods are transported from distribution centers to multiple stores; and e-commerce, where packages are consolidated for delivery to customers in a specific geographic area. Additionally, food and beverage companies, such as those distributing perishable goods, can also benefit from milk runs, as they enable timely and efficient delivery. By implementing a milk run, companies in these industries can achieve cost savings through reduced transportation costs, improved delivery times, and increased supply chain visibility, ultimately enhancing their overall operational efficiency.

What challenges can arise when implementing a milk run?

Implementing a milk run logistics system, a highly efficient method for delivering goods to multiple locations in a predetermined sequence, can present some unique challenges. One hurdle is route optimization, as constantly changing customer demands and unexpected events like traffic congestion can disrupt carefully planned routes. Additionally, coordinating deliveries with multiple suppliers and customers can be complex, requiring meticulous communication and scheduling. Investing in robust routing software and establishing clear protocols for communication can help mitigate these challenges and ensure the success of your milk run operation.

Can a milk run strategy work for small businesses?

Can a milk run strategy work for small businesses? Absolutely, and it’s becoming increasingly popular as a means to optimize logistics and reduce overhead costs. This approach, which involves suppliers delivering smaller, more frequent shipments directly to businesses, can streamline operations significantly. For instance, a small bakery that relies on fresh ingredients can benefit immensely from a milk run strategy. Instead of ordering a truckload of supplies once a month, the bakery can receive smaller deliveries of flour, sugar, and other essentials daily. This not only keeps ingredients fresh but also ensures that there’s no excess inventory taking up valuable space. Additionally, scheduling frequent, smaller deliveries can help manage cash flow better, as payments are spread out over time rather than in large lump sums. Implementing a milk run strategy requires coordination with suppliers willing to adapt to the frequency you need, which might take some negotiation. However, the long-term benefits of lower storage costs, reduced waste, and improved inventory management often outweigh the initial effort. By integrating a milk run strategy, small businesses can enhance efficiency, keep operating costs low, and focus more on growth and customer satisfaction.

Does implementing a milk run require significant changes in infrastructure?

Implementing a milk run logistics strategy can be an efficient way to reduce transportation costs and improve supply chain operations. While it does require some adjustments, it doesn’t necessarily demand significant changes in infrastructure. A milk run involves consolidating shipments from multiple suppliers or locations into a single vehicle, which can be achieved through route optimization and scheduling. To successfully implement a milk run, companies may need to reconfigure their logistics networks, invest in route planning software, and establish strong communication channels with suppliers and carriers. However, the existing infrastructure can often be leveraged, with modifications made to accommodate the new logistics strategy, such as adjusting delivery schedules and loading/unloading procedures. By doing so, businesses can reap the benefits of a milk run, including reduced transportation costs, lower emissions, and improved supply chain visibility, without requiring a complete overhaul of their infrastructure.
